WebThe processing of raw materials into usable forms is termed fabrication or conversion. An example from the plastics industry would be the conversion of plastic pellets into films or the conversion of films into food containers. WebThermoplastic polymers are routinely made into millimeter size pellets (which are also known as granules). Extra steps are needed to convert these pellets to powder. Mechanical grinding is commonly used, but care is needed to keep the polymer from overheating and forming filaments and irregular shapes.

A polyolefin is a type of polymer with the general formula (CH 2 CHR) n where R is an alkyl group. They are usually derived from a small set of simple olefins ( alkenes ). Dominant in a commercial sense are polyethylene and polypropylene. More specialized polyolefins include polyisobutylene and polymethylpentene. how is a permanent magnetic created
